This article is adopted in order to protect the environment, particularly the wildlife, and the health, safety and well-being of persons and property by prohibiting the release of helium balloons into the atmosphere, including latex and Mylar, as it has been determined that the release of balloons inflated with lighter-than-air gases poses a danger and nuisance to the environment, particularly to wildlife and marine animals so as to constitute a public nuisance and may pose a threat to the safety of its inhabitants and their property.
